We are seeking a Network and Systems Administrator to join our team in Bloomington, Indiana. This position entails the configuration, maintenance, and troubleshooting of company hardware, software and networks.
StatusCurrently accepting applications.
LocationBloomington, Indiana, USA
Responsibilities- Install, maintain and administer computer networks and related computing environments, including computer hardware, systems software, applications software, and all configurations.
- Diagnose, troubleshoot, and resolve hardware, software, or other network and system problems and replace defective components when necessary.
- Plan, coordinate, and implement network security measures to protect data, software and hardware, including the virus protection software
- Operate master consoles to monitor the performance of computer systems and networks, and to coordinate computer network access and use.
- Evaluate user needs, perform a comprehensive search/compare, and procure computer software and hardware, maintain adequate supplies (spare drives, printer paper, toners, etc,)
- Design, assemble, configure and test computer hardware and networking and operating system software.
- Monitor network performance to determine whether adjustments need to be made, and to determine where changes will need to be made in the future.
- Assist in configuring, monitoring, and maintaining email applications.
- Assist in perform data backups and disaster recovery operations.
